- Devil's Haste ••
- Similar to the first rank, the infernalist is calling forth the corruption of Namtaru in order to taint themselves or a willing target. However, this time the corruption would not taint their body, but their very blood, making it appear like black ichor. Willing targets who don't practice foul art would always be overwhelmed by this effect and might give in into their beast.
- System:
- The player spends a blood point, rolls as mentioned above and split the successes between effect and duration.
- Effect: Each success that was splitted into effect would provide additional Celerity dot.
- Duration: Each success that was splitted into duration would provide additional turn the effect takes place. If no successes were splitted into Duration the effect would last for a single turn.
- A botched roll would result in terrifying consequences as something would go wrong with the blood transformation, the amount of 1's dices would represnt the aggravated inflicted.
- Dark Teleportation ••••
- At this rank the infernalist may actually tear a hole between the dimensions, a hole that would be big enough to suck the infernalist's body and spit them out in another desired location.
- System:
- The player has to roll as mentioned above, each success would represent how far the infernalist may teleport themselves.
- 1 Success: 10 Kilometers
- 2 Successes: 30 Kilometers
- 3 Successes: 70 Kilometers
- 4 Successes: 150 Kilometers
- 5 Successes+: The infernalist may travel between countries.
- Botch: The infernalist gets stuck in the Outer Dark. A place where physics don't apply, making their body crush under the pressure. Dealing 2 aggravated per turn, the infernalist has to quickly draw themselves out before the place would consume them entirely.
